Abstract: Listed among the Top Four of the Yuan Dynasty (1279-1368), Ni Zan attained equally outstanding achievement as a calligrapher of the hermitage school as an artist. Natural, not luxurious and somewhat far from the madding crowd, the style of his calligraphy promoted the poem-calligraphy-painting trinity to a new height. Departing from the prefaces and postscripts of Ni Zan's calligraphy works, the paper focuses on analysis of the unique quality of his fine-size works, the affinity between the style of calligraphy and the artistic attainment of painting, and the seals attached to his calligraphy works, so as to explore an unbeaten track in the study of Ni Zan and his calligraphy.
